In this episode, Valerie officially hits her breaking point with the so-called “dating pool” spoiler alert: it’s not a pool, it’s a septic tank. She unpacks the parade of disasters that men keep marching into her life: the fixer-upper who drains her energy and leaves her guilty for walking away, the scam artist who love-bombed and gaslit his way straight into a wedding, the background lurker who turns every ‘hello’ into a sleazy pass, and the “respectable” one who can’t keep a conversation platonic to save his life.
Raw, unfiltered, and fed up, Valerie calls out how exhausting it is to crave genuine male companionship a friend to just hang out, eat snacks, watch a movie without it being twisted into something sexual. With humor, rage, and zero sugarcoating, she roasts the illusion men project versus the hot garbage hiding underneath.
This is Valerie at her realest: no holding back, no fake roses, just truth bombs and scorched earth honesty. Tune in for a crashout episode that proves one thing: the red flags aren’t just waving, they’re on fire.
